Understanding the Stove Air Filter’s Core Mission
Unlike filters on your furnace or HVAC system, a stove air filter serves specific and vital functions directly tied to cooking activities and stove operation. Primarily found on electric ranges – especially smooth-top or glass cooktops – and downdraft ventilation systems, its main jobs are:
- Protecting Internal Components: It prevents dust, cooking by-products (like fine grease particles, flour, sugar), and debris from entering the sensitive electronic or mechanical components inside the appliance cabinet. This debris, when drawn in by cooling fans, can accumulate on circuit boards, wiring, and motors, leading to overheating, short circuits, corrosion, and premature failure of expensive parts.
- Ensuring Proper Cooling: Electric stoves generate significant heat, especially during prolonged high-heat cooking like boiling or oven use. Internal fans draw in ambient air to cool these components. A clean filter allows sufficient airflow. A clogged filter restricts this vital cooling air, causing components to overheat, reducing lifespan, and potentially creating fire hazards.
- Maintaining Downdraft Ventilation Efficiency: If your stove incorporates a downdraft system that rises from the cooktop surface, the air filter is the first line of defense. It captures larger grease particles and debris before they reach the more intricate (and harder-to-clean) blower motor and exhaust ducting. A clean filter here ensures maximum smoke and odor extraction power.
- Improving Ambient Air Quality: While not its primary function like a dedicated range hood filter, a stove air filter does capture some airborne grease and particles that could otherwise circulate and settle on nearby cabinets, walls, and countertops, contributing to kitchen grime.
Where to Find Your Stove Air Filter and Common Varieties
The location can vary by stove model and brand, but common placements include:
- Vent Grille (Bottom Front/Rear): For most electric ranges and slide-in stoves, the air filter is located behind a long, narrow grille (louvered panel) at the bottom front of the appliance, just above the kickplate or toe kick. This grille may run the entire width of the stove or be centered. Some models place similar vents on the rear underside.
- Backsplash Area: Some downdraft cooktop systems integrate the filter directly into the downdraft unit housed within the cooktop assembly or immediately behind it in a dedicated compartment.
- Lower Control Panel: Less commonly, filters might be accessible by opening a small door or removing a panel just below the oven door or control knobs.
To access it, you typically need to remove the vent grille or panel. This often involves gently squeezing sides or pressing tabs to release it. Refer to your owner's manual for the exact procedure for your model.
Common types of stove air filters include:
- Mesh Filters: Constructed from fine metal mesh (often aluminum or stainless steel) woven tightly. These are durable, washable (non-disposable), and effective at catching larger particles. Some have a fluted design to increase surface area.
- Foam Filters: Made from specialized, heat-resistant open-cell polyurethane foam. These trap finer dust and grease particles and are generally disposable. Some washable foam filters exist but are less common.
- Combination Filters: Some filters feature both a metal mesh frame and a foam insert layered together for enhanced filtration, capturing both large debris and fine particulates.
- Charcoal Filters (Downdraft Specific): While the main filter protects the blower, some downdraft systems also incorporate a secondary activated charcoal filter solely for odor reduction, similar to range hoods. These are separate from the primary air intake filter protecting the motor and electronics.

Choosing the Right Replacement Stove Air Filter
This is critical. Never assume filters are interchangeable across brands or even model lines. Using the wrong filter can cause poor fit, inadequate sealing, and insufficient airflow, defeating the purpose. Here’s how to find the perfect match:
- Locate Your Stove's Model Number: This is the golden ticket. Find it usually on a metal plate or sticker inside the oven door frame, on the back of the broiler or storage drawer frame, on the cabinet near the bottom door hinge, or sometimes on the door edge itself. Write this number down precisely (e.g., "JGBC56DESS01").
- Use the Model Number: Enter this exact model number into the search bar of appliance parts retailers (like Repair Clinic, Appliance Parts Pros, Sears PartsDirect) or major retailers' parts sections. Your stove manufacturer's official parts website is also reliable. This ensures you get the filter designed specifically for your appliance.
- Visually Match (If Necessary): If you can't find the model number, carefully remove the existing filter. Look for a part number printed on its frame or edge. You can also compare its dimensions (length, width, thickness), overall shape (flat, fluted, rectangular), and material (mesh, foam) visually against replacement options online using retailer filters. Take a photo! This method is less foolproof than using the model number but works if done meticulously.
- Choose Material Wisely: Mesh filters are generally preferred for durability and washability. Foam filters require replacement more frequently but offer superior filtration for fine particles. Check your manual's recommendation.
- Buy Genuine OEM vs. Quality Aftermarket: Original Equipment Manufacturer (OEM) filters guarantee an exact fit. However, reputable aftermarket brands (Certified Appliance Accessories, Filtersfast, etc.) often provide equivalent filtration and fit at a lower cost. Avoid unknown generic brands with poor construction.
Maintaining Your Stove Air Filter: The Cleaning Ritual
Regular maintenance is non-negotiable. Frequency depends heavily on cooking habits:
- Heavy Cooking (Daily frying, roasting, baking): Inspect monthly; clean/replace at least every 2-3 months.
- Average Cooking (Several times a week): Inspect every 2 months; clean/replace every 4-6 months.
- Light Cooking (Occasional use): Inspect every 3 months; clean/replace every 6-12 months.
- After Spills/Significant Mess: Clean immediately regardless of schedule.
Cleaning a Washable Mesh Filter:
- Turn off Stove & Unplug: Safety first. Unplug the stove or turn off power at the circuit breaker. Let the stove cool completely.
- Remove the Filter: Carefully release the vent grille/panel and slide out the filter.
- Initial Debris Removal: Tap the filter gently over a trash can to dislodge large crumbs and loose debris. A soft brush can help.
- Soak in Cleaning Solution: Fill a sink or basin with very hot water and add a generous amount of dish soap. Alternatively, mix a degreaser solution (following product instructions). Submerge the filter completely. Let it soak for 15-30 minutes. For tough grease, add 1/4 cup baking soda to the soapy water.
- Scrub Gently: Use a soft nylon brush or non-scratch sponge to work the solution through the mesh. Be thorough, especially on the greasiest side facing the interior. Never use steel wool or abrasive cleaners – they damage the metal.
- Rinse Thoroughly: Rinse the filter under running hot water until the water runs clear and all soap residue is gone. Ensure water flows freely through all mesh openings.
- Dry Completely: Shake off excess water. Place the filter on a clean towel in a well-ventilated area, not in direct sunlight or near heat sources. Let it air dry 100% before reinstalling. Damp filters promote mold and dust adhesion faster.
- Reinstall: Once bone dry, slide the filter securely back into its slot and reattach the grille/panel. Ensure it’s sealed correctly with no gaps.
Disposing of and Replacing a Disposable Filter:
- Turn off Power: Follow the same safety steps as above.
- Remove Old Filter: Carefully take out the clogged filter.
- Dispose Properly: Place it in a bag and discard in the trash.
- Install New Filter: Unpack the new, correct replacement filter. Insert it exactly as the old one was positioned, paying attention to airflow direction markings (if any) – usually arrows indicating the correct flow direction (air flowing into the stove). Ensure it's fully seated and the grille/panel closes securely.
Addressing Common Stove Air Filter Problems
- Filter Is Damaged (Ripped Mesh, Crushed Foam): Replace immediately. A damaged filter allows debris into the appliance, defeating its purpose.
- Filter Seems Clean but Appliance Overheats: Check that the filter is installed correctly and in the right orientation. Verify it's the exact model recommended. Listen for proper fan operation – the cooling fan might have failed independently.
- Filter Gets Clogged Extremely Fast: Investigate the cooking environment. Is there excessive loose flour/sugar use? Deep frying without a dedicated range hood cover venting steam/grease? Ensure you're not blocking the filter's air intake area with items stored under the stove. Significantly accelerated clogging can indicate another internal problem.
- Rattling or Vibrating Noise: Ensure the filter is securely seated in its slot and the grille/panel is latched correctly. A loose filter can vibrate against the housing when the internal fan operates.
- Cannot Locate the Filter: Consult your stove's owner’s manual. You can often find digital copies online by searching your model number + "owner's manual." Contact the manufacturer's customer support if needed. Not all stoves have an intake air filter (some rely only on rear vents with internal protective grills).
